The Tallyhook platform now ships a native integration with the Sprocketline barcode scanner family. Plugin authors can subscribe to scan events through the new `scanEvents` hook instead of polling the device bridge; the old polling interface is deprecated and will be removed in v3.0. Supported symbologies include EAN, Code 128, and QR. Sample plugins and migration notes are in the developer handbook. Compatibility questions and deprecation exceptions should be directed to the integration owner named below.

named custodian: Zorwyn Kaswyn Jorath Aldok

Q3 Planning Note — Sales Leads

The Lumivex Pro launch is confirmed for the second week of October, starting with the Harrowgate and Delmere territories. Pricing sheets and demo kits ship to regional offices by late September. Marek's team will run enablement sessions the first week of October; attendance is mandatory for all leads. Pipeline targets for the launch quarter will be set at 120% of standard. Before briefing your teams, review the note below.

board note of bawep-tajef: Queniusek Systems plans to raise the Quenvan list price by 53.1 percent in March. The pricing group signed off on a budget of $176.4 million for Project Drueth. The renewal with Casionix Partners closes at $142.5 million a year, 8.3 percent below the last contract. Project Fraax slips by six weeks because of the tooling delay.

# Runbook: Hunting leaked file descriptors in Quillgate

When the `fd_open` gauge climbs steadily between deploys, suspect a leak rather than load. First confirm on a single pod: exec in and count entries under `/proc/1/fd`, noting how many are sockets in CLOSE_WAIT versus regular files. Capture two snapshots ten minutes apart before restarting anything — we need the delta for the postmortem. Reproduce locally with the Marbury load harness, which requires the service running with the following configuration values.

settings of yagep-bajog:
[istdor]
port = 4000
region = south-2
host = istdor.qorvelcorp.internal
timeout_ms = 5000
retries = 5